Web12 sep. 2024 · Tensile strain is the measure of the deformation of an object under tensile stress and is defined as the fractional change of the object’s length when the object experiences tensile stress tensile strain = ΔL L0. Compressive stress and strain are defined by the same formulas, Equations 12.4.5 and 12.4.6, respectively. WebStrain gauges are devices that are commonly used by engineers to measure the effect of external forces on an object. They measure strain directly, which can be used to indirectly determine stress, torque, pressure, deflection, and many other measurements. WebThe average strain is calculated as (ɛx+ ɛy)/2 and plotted on the X axis where the shear strain is zero. Using the calculated normal and shear strains, two points (ɛx, ɛxy) and (ɛy, -ɛxy) are plotted on the graph.
